Compensation for small-scale phase distortions using a Fourier phase corrector

S. I. Kliment'ev, V. V. Kononov, V. I. Kuprenyuk, L. D. Smirnova, V. V. Sergeev, V. E. Sherstobitov


Abstract: It is demonstrated experimentally that efficient compensation for small-scale phase distortions of a CO2 laser waverfront can be achieved by using a Zernike cell type of wavefront-reversal system. After passing twice through the phase plate the Strehl number of the beam increases from 0.43 to 0.86 due to the compensation. The main factors determining the quality of the compensation for the distortions are discussed.
